Te4(TaCl6)2 (TaTe2Cl6) Crystal Structure
General Information
- Phase Label(s): TaTe2Cl6
- Structure Class(es): –
- Classification by Properties: –
- Mineral Name(s): –
- Pearson Symbol: aP18
- Space Group: 2
- Phase Prototype: TaTe2Cl6
- Measurement Detail(s): automatic diffractometer; 206 (determination of cell parameters), automatic diffractometer; STOE IPDS (determination of structural parameters), X-rays, Mo Kα; λ = 0.071073 nm (determination of cell and structural parameters)
- Phase Class(es): –
- Compound Class(es): chloride
- Interpretation Detail(s): complete structure determined, least-squares refinement; 82 variables; 2123 reflections; F > 4σ(F), R = 0.036; wR = 0.100
- Sample Detail(s): sample prepared from TeCl4, Te, TaCl5, single crystal (determination of cell and structural parameters)
Substance Summary
- Standard Formula: TaTe2Cl6
- Alphabetic Formula: Cl6TaTe2
- Published Formula: Te4(TaCl6)2
- Refined Formula: Cl6TaTe2
- Wyckoff Sequence: 2,i9
- Z Formula Units: 2
- Density: ρ = 4.16 Mg·m−3
